- Running is a popular sport, but it can cause stress and exhaustion, especially in events like marathons.
- Professional runners train rigorously, up to three times a day, pushing their bodies to the limit, often leading to brief high-level careers.
- Amateur and professional runners share similarities in marathon preparation, including identical training loads and risks of injury.
- Amateurs are more prone to stress-related injuries due to less medical and general support compared to professionals.
- Trail running, especially ultra-trail, presents additional challenges like irregular terrain, long durations, and mental fatigue.
- Training involves wearing out the body to improve resistance, a principle also used in physical rehabilitation programs.
- Both amateurs and professionals need good coaching to manage training progression and avoid burnout.
- Running requires no special equipment but awareness of its risks and limitations is crucial for enjoyment and health benefits.
